[160], The 201112 Harvard team defeated then-ranked Florida State (#22 AP Poll #20 Coaches' Poll) on November 25, 2011 for the school's second win over a ranked team in the program's history,[161] and the highest ranked opponent in the Coaches' Poll that Harvard had defeated up to that point. [197][198], In addition to his coaching duties at Harvard, Amaker serves as a Special Assistant to Harvard University President Larry Bacow and a Spring 2021 Fellow[199][200] at the Hauser Center for Public Leadership at the Harvard Kennedy School. [147], Under Amaker's leadership, the 201011 team tied with Princeton for the 201011 Ivy League men's basketball season championship, which was the school's first men's basketball Ivy League championship since the league was formed in the 195657 season. Amaker played at Duke from 1983 to '87, and he still holds the school record for consecutive games started (138). [1] Amaker's 201112, 201213, 201314 and 201415 teams repeated as Ivy League champions.
